Why do we love this wine?

Low-yielding, high quality vineyards are what this iconic producer are all about. This is must have been a beast in its youth because an aged wine, we're blown away but the concentration and power of the fruit. A distinctly varietal nose with blackberry, cassis, pencil shavings and mint. The palate shows us the value of bottle-ageing premium cabernet; leather, tobacco, french oak and spice take the lead whilst velvet-like tannins and subtle natural acid build a lengthy, satisfying finish. To put it simply, tasty, textured and downright tremendous.

Frequently Asked Questions

At 14 years of age, this Cabernet has reached that sweet spot where primary fruit flavours have evolved into complex secondary and tertiary characteristics. The transformation from youthful blackberry and cassis to sophisticated leather, tobacco and spice notes demonstrates why premium Cabernet Sauvignon from quality producers like Hutton Vale Farm can age gracefully for decades. Museum releases represent wines that have been carefully cellared and are now drinking at their peak maturity.

Eden Valley's high altitude and cool climate create the perfect conditions for Cabernet Sauvignon to develop the structural backbone needed for long-term ageing. The region's diurnal temperature variation helps retain natural acidity while allowing full flavour development, which is evident in this wine's ability to maintain freshness after 14 years. The cooler conditions also contribute to the distinctive mint and eucalyptus characters often found in Eden Valley Cabernets.

The 'velvet-like tannins' described here showcase how time transforms the initially firm, sometimes aggressive tannins of young Cabernet into something silky and integrated. This polymerisation process occurs over years in bottle, where tannin molecules bind together and soften, creating a smoother mouthfeel while still providing structure. It's this evolution that makes aged premium Cabernet so sought after by collectors and connoisseurs.

The wine's developed leather and tobacco notes, combined with its full body and integrated tannins, make it perfect for rich, slow-cooked dishes like braised beef short ribs or lamb shanks. The earthy characteristics and spice elements also complement aged cheeses, particularly hard varieties like aged cheddar or Parmigiano-Reggiano. The wine's maturity means it can handle bold flavours without being overwhelmed.

Low yields concentrate flavours and create wines with greater intensity and ageing potential, which is clearly evident in this wine's remarkable concentration after 14 years. By limiting grape production per vine, Hutton Vale Farm ensures each berry develops maximum flavour compounds and tannin structure. This philosophy of quality over quantity is what separates iconic producers from commercial operations and explains why this wine has earned 95 points from James Halliday.
